A circle has a diameter with endpoints (-7, -1) and (-5, -9). What is the equation of the circle? r2 = (x + 6)2 + (y + 5)2 r2 =
Fantom [35]
Answer: (x + 6)² + (y + 5)² = 17

Explanation:

1)  The equation of a circle is: (x - a)² + (y - b)² = r², wnere:
a is the x-coordinate of the center of the circleb is the y-coordinate of the center of the circler is the radius of the circle
2) Since the points (-7,-1) and (-5,9) define a diameter, you can find the center of the circle as the mid point of the diameter:
x-coordinate of the mid point = (-7 - 5) / 2 = - 12 / 2 = - 6
y-coordinate of the mid point = (-9 - 1)/ 2 = - 10 / 2 = - 5

Therefore, the center of the circle is (-6,-5)

3) The radius of the center is half the diameter.
The length of the diameter is found using the formula for the distance between two points applied to the two endopoints given:
diameter² = (7 - 5)² + (- 1 + 9)² = 2² + 8² = 4 + 64 = 68

⇒diameter = √68 = 2√17

⇒ radius = diamter / 2 = 2√17 / 2 = √17

4) Now you can replace the coordinates of the center and the radius into the equation:
(x + 6)² + (y + 5)² = 17

A slow pitch softball diamond is actually a square 60 ft on a side. how far is it from home to second ​base?
krek1111 [17]
For this case we have a square whose sides are known and equal to 60 ft.
 We want to find the diagonal of the square.
 For this, we use the Pythagorean theorem.
 We have then:
 d^2 = 60^2 + 60^2

d =  \sqrt{60^2 + 60^2}

 d =  \sqrt{3600 + 3600}

d = \sqrt{2*3600}

d = 60\sqrt{2}

 Answer:
 
from home to second ​base it is about:
 d = 60\sqrt{2} feet
